Whether you have no idea what a magic circle is, let alone how to create one, or you’re looking for new challenges, inspiration or tips to improve, Hey Hey, Let’s Crochet! brings out the best stitching in all.

With Pauline Greaves bringing decades of pro hooking and committed teaching to your crochet cause, this fun 10-week course will have you yarning for more.

10-week series of classes, 1 Oct - 17 Dec

What:
This 10-week crochet course is targeted at beginners and intermediate, or those with some skills but looking to discover more or work on new challenges. Whether to relax, learn new skills or create award-winning pieces, you will learn all the essentials whilst working on projects including a cocoon cardigan and a cushion. Plus create your own unique piece to take out a prize at the Canning Show.

Instructor:
Pauline Greaves brings 40+ years of experience crocheting to her facilitator role, including as founder of a crochet club. Pauline will show you all the tricks of the crochet world, help with any projects, share her great ideas, and guide you to creating all sorts of wonderful woollies, beautiful blankets, or whatever your imagination may conjure.

To Bring:
Your crochet hook and some yarn to get started.
